Understanding Visual Recognition Technology

Visual recognition involves leveraging artificial intelligence (AI) to identify, classify, and interpret content within images and documents. This technology encompasses tools like Optical Character Recognition (OCR) and advanced machine learning algorithms that provide enhanced accuracy and efficiency compared to traditional manual methods of data entry and quality assurance.

The Growing Need for Intelligent Document Processing

With the acceleration of digital transformation, organizations are facing an influx of documents that require management and analysis. The manual processing of these documents can be labor-intensive, prone to human error, and inefficient. Intelligent Document Processing (IDP), powered by visual recognition, has emerged as a vital solution to these challenges. Here’s how:

  • Automated Data Extraction: IDP systems equipped with visual recognition capabilities can extract data from documents with remarkable accuracy, regardless of format, whether it’s invoices, contracts, or health records.
  • Multi-Format Support: Modern IDP solutions can process various file types, including PDFs, images, and Microsoft Office documents, thus breaking down information silos within organizations.
  • Contextual Processing: By understanding the content and relationships between pieces of information, IDP transforms simple text extraction into intelligent insights, ensuring that relevant data is categorized and retrieved efficiently.

Enhancing Quality Control Through Visual Recognition

Quality control is critical to maintaining product standards across manufacturing, logistics, and service industries. Visual recognition technology acts as a transformative catalyst in this arena, automating inspection processes to ensure product quality and consistency. Here’s how:

  • Automated Defect Detection: AI image recognition systems can perform real-time inspections, detecting defects such as scratches, color discrepancies, and component misalignments that manual inspections might overlook.
  • Assembly Verification: Visual recognition verifies that all components are correctly placed and assembled, minimizing errors that could lead to functional defects and safety hazards.
  • Dimensional and Tolerance Checks: By analyzing images, manufacturers ensure that products meet dimensional specifications and tolerances, preventing defective products from reaching customers.

Challenges and Considerations

While the integration of visual recognition technologies offers numerous advantages, organizations must consider challenges such as the initial setup, training required for AI models, and ensuring data security and compliance in handling sensitive information. A thoughtful approach to implementing these technologies can mitigate these risks and facilitate successful adoption.
